    1. High Efficiency Filtration Performance

    The automotive engine air filter utilizes advanced filtration materials, including multi-layer composite filter paper and high-performance non-woven fabrics. These materials feature a fine fiber structure that effectively captures particles as small as 5 microns, achieving a filtration efficiency of over 99%. This ensures that the air entering the engine is exceptionally clean, significantly reducing the risk of engine wear and damage from abrasive particles like sand, pollen, and industrial dust.

    Additionally, the filter's specialized design allows it to block a wide range of particle sizes, from large debris to microscopic contaminants. This comprehensive protection acts as a barrier against impurities, safeguarding critical engine components such as pistons, cylinder walls, and valves.

    Installation and Maintenance Guide

    Installation Procedure

    1. Open the engine hood and locate the air filter box near the engine air intake.
    2. Loosen the fixing clip or screw on the air filter box cover and remove it.
    3. Gently remove the old air filter element, ensuring no dust enters the intake pipe.
    4. Place the new filter element into the box in the correct orientation, ensuring a secure fit.
    5. Reinstall the cover and tighten the clip or screws.
    6. Close the engine hood to complete the installation.

    Maintenance Recommendations

    • Inspect the filter element regularly, typically every 5,000 kilometers, or more frequently in dusty environments.
    • Clean the filter with compressed air if it becomes dusty, avoiding excessive pressure that could damage the material.
    • Replace the filter if it is heavily soiled or worn out. Never reuse damaged or expired filters.
    • During replacements, check the intake pipe and filter box for debris and clean them to maintain airflow efficiency.
